XDEE.DE vs. SPQH.DE
XDEE.DE (Xtrackers S&P 500 Equal Weight UCITS ETF EUR Hedged (Acc)) and SPQH.DE (Global X S&P 500 Quarterly Tail Hedge UCITS ETF USD Accumulating) are both exchange-traded funds - XDEE.DE is a S&P 500 fund tracking the S&P 500 Equal Weight Index (EUR Hedged), while SPQH.DE is a Defined Outcome fund tracking the Cboe S&P 500 15% WHT Quarterly 9% (-3% to -12%) Buffer Protect Index. Both are passively managed. Over the past 3 years, XDEE.DE returned 11.69%/yr vs 6.55%/yr for SPQH.DE. At a 0.22 correlation, their price movements are largely independent. XDEE.DE charges 0.30%/yr vs 0.50%/yr for SPQH.DE.
